How to Transform E-commerce Logistics in Australia with Innovative Solutions

 

Assessing Current Logistics Practices

Identifying Pain Points

In the heart of Melbourne's bustling CBD business district, many e-commerce entrepreneurs grapple with common logistics challenges. Unanticipated delays, inefficient supply chain processes, and lacklustre communication often hinder progress. As e-commerce consultants, identifying these pain points becomes a crucial first step. Exploring the unique operational nuances of each business enables a keen understanding of their specific struggles. Whether it's a tech startup in Cremorne struggling with inventory management or a vibrant e-commerce venture in South Melbourne seeking a balance in vendor relationships, pinpointing issues helps navigate the complexities of logistics.

Evaluating Efficiency Levels

Once we pinpoint the challenges, the next step is closely evaluating the efficiency of existing systems. Examining warehouse layouts, reviewing vendor collaborations, and assessing transportation plans provides insight into what's working and what's not. For many local businesses, utilising third party logistics can streamline operations and deliver enhanced flexibility. Leveraging data-driven insights and strategy insights during this evaluation can identify areas for improvement, thereby optimising logistics workflows.

Mapping Out Current Processes

Documenting and visualising current logistics processes creates a clear picture of the workflow, from procurement to customer delivery. This approach offers a bird's-eye view of the system, revealing bottlenecks and redundancies. By mapping processes, business owners unlock opportunities for integration of 3PL services and technology-driven solutions. This comprehensive review is an essential step towards crafting logistics strategies that drive efficiency and growth, setting the stage for meaningful transformation.

Embracing Technology

Implementing AI in Logistics

As a consultant in Melbourne's dynamic logistics scene, I constantly encounter businesses eager to optimize their operations. Embracing AI technologies has proven transformative in ecommerce logistics. For small to mid-sized e-commerce businesses, AI can streamline operations, reduce errors, and enhance decision-making capabilities. Think of the bustling activity in the tech startups of Cremorne, where AI is integrated into logistics processes to manage and predict inventory needs with accuracy and speed. By utilising AI-powered forecasting tools, these businesses can anticipate demand trends and optimise their supply chain accordingly. This is not merely a tech trend but an opportunity to refine logistics strategies on a fundamental level.

Using Data Analytics

In this thriving e-commerce environment, data analytics emerge as a powerful tool to gain valuable insights and optimise logistics operations. With access to comprehensive data sets, businesses can identify inefficiencies, track performance metrics, and strategize future actions. Imagine the bustling energy in South Melbourne's e-commerce hub, where data-driven decision-making helps streamline operations from shipping practices to pick and pack efficiency. By analysing customer behaviour and operational performance, businesses can tailor their logistics approach to enhance customer satisfaction and reduce costs.

Exploring Automation Tools

Integrating automation tools in logistics offers an immediate boost in operational efficiency. Whether it's automating inventory updates or simplifying shipment processes, automation reduces the chances of manual errors and accelerates workflow. In the Melbourne CBD business district, adopting automated solutions paves the way for businesses to remain competitive and responsive to consumer demands. Automation tools seamlessly connect various logistics elements, ensuring a more cohesive and timely operation, which is indispensable in today's e-commerce landscape.

Sustainable Logistics Strategies

Eco-Friendly Packaging Solutions

As someone passionate about sustainable logistics, it’s exciting to see how eco-friendly packaging can offer a robust solution to the mounting environmental issues in the Melbourne CBD business district. Many e-commerce businesses are making a conscious shift towards materials that reduce waste and enhance sustainability. This can include using biodegradable packages, recycled materials, or minimalistic designs that cut down on excess.

Optimizing Transportation

Effective transportation strategies are becoming increasingly critical for e-commerce businesses, especially given the vibrant e-commerce scene in South Melbourne. Optimisation involves selecting the right modes of transport, such as hybrid vehicles or electric vans, which can significantly decrease carbon footprints. Route optimisation through advanced software can also reduce fuel consumption and improve delivery efficiencies, aligning with the innovative spirit seen in tech startups in Cremorne.

Implementing Circular Supply Chains

Incorporating circular supply chains can redefine business operations by fundamentally shifting from a linear to a regenerative model. This approach involves designing products with their end-of-life in mind, promoting reusability and recycling to limit resource consumption. A 3PL warehouse can play a vital role here, providing essential support for the return and reuse processes, thus closing the loop in a business’s logistics chain.

This sustainable paradigm encourages businesses to rethink and redesign their supply chains, creating opportunities for significant environmental impact reduction. Embracing these strategies can not only enhance operational efficiency but also contribute to a greener, more sustainable future.

Enhancing Customer Experience

Improving Delivery Times

In the vibrant world of e-commerce, enhancing delivery times plays a pivotal role in customer satisfaction. With a focus on streamlined logistics, it's essential to consider strategies like optimising warehouse operations through innovative practices. For instance, integrating efficient pick packing techniques can significantly speed up the process, resulting in faster order fulfilment and happier customers. Implementing these strategies requires careful analysis and continuous adjustments to ensure that delivery systems meet or exceed customer expectations.

Offering Personalized Services

Personalisation in the e-commerce logistics realm means tailoring experiences to fit customer preferences. Offering personalised services can range from customising delivery options to anticipating customer needs using data insights. This approach not only builds loyalty but also enhances the overall shopping experience, making customers feel valued and understood. For small to mid-sized e-commerce businesses in South Melbourne, embracing this strategy can set them apart in a competitive market.

Ensuring Hassle-Free Returns

A seamless returns process is crucial for maintaining a positive customer relationship. Implementing an efficient returns policy involves clear communication, easy-to-follow procedures, and a focus on convenience for the customer. In Melbourne's bustling business district, providing hassle-free returns can significantly enhance customer experience, encouraging repeat business and positive word-of-mouth. Streamlining this aspect of logistics can transform potential dissatisfaction into an opportunity for strengthening customer loyalty.

Common Errors in Logistics Transformation

Misjudging Future Growth Potential

One of the critical missteps small to mid-sized e-commerce businesses often make is overlooking scalability. Especially in the fast-paced Melbourne CBD business district, where growth can be rapid and unpredictable, planning for scalability is non-negotiable. When we develop logistics strategies, we should imagine them as skeletons capable of adapting and growing as the business expands. It’s essential to weave in adaptability right from the start, accommodating future spikes in demand without overhauling existing systems. This foresight spares us from the pitfalls of constant re-strategising.

Overlooking the Value of Workforce Development

Another common oversight is neglecting the crucial element of workforce training. In the bustling heart of tech innovation like Cremorne, businesses cannot afford to ignore the importance of upskilling. The integration of AI, automation, and other advanced technologies demands a workforce that's not only aware but proficient in these tools. Providing regular training sessions ensures your team remains a robust asset instead of a liability. It boosts efficiency and keeps operations seamless, crucial when competing within South Melbourne's vibrant e-commerce scene.

Misjudging the Time Required for Implementation

Yet another pitfall is underestimating the timeframes involved in implementing new processes and systems. Change, especially in logistics and supply chains, isn't instantaneous. Recognising the realistic period for transitioning allows us to set achievable goals, thereby reducing frustration and disruption. By building buffer time into project plans, businesses can align new systems with existing operations smoothly. Embracing a realistic perspective on timelines turns logistical transformation from a daunting task into a strategic opportunity.
